My Students
I am a Kindergarten teacher in a public school system. Our school population is eighty percent Hispanic. Our parents are working class people who care about their children and see education as a way for their children to have a better future. They are very supportive of their children and of our neighborhood school.
My goal is to teach my students to be enthusiastic and independent learners.
Many of my students come to me with no formal educational experience. Since Kindergarten is the foundation for all the years to come, it is so important for me to make sure that I not only teach my students needed subject matter, but also teach them to love learning. This is a mission I take very seriously.
My Project
I am fortunate enough to have a rather large classroom. There is ample room for my Kindergarten students to learn and explore their world. We have tables for working, floor space for projects and I am interested in establishing a gathering space for Circle Time.
Communicating with others is an important skill to learn so that a child can become a well-adjusted adult.
This classroom carpet will allow us a gathering place to practice sharing our thoughts and feelings with each other. Here we can sing, talk and learn together. We can have a safe, consistent place to meet to share thoughts and feelings. A place for sharing is a place for caring.
